Output 3fabdf7b4cefc8eb106934206d5e36cc052226b86dec01a545c208a2d75ca997:44

value
91260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04d044e796d24c05c9153c7c88fbadb2c243d00f OP_EQUAL
address
328U876ZKF92nWx2WGDNKp4WogYxrxuFPS
transaction
3fabdf7b4cefc8eb106934206d5e36cc052226b86dec01a545c208a2d75ca997
confirmations
26786
spent
true